What are Wooden Pallet Auctions?
Wooden pallet auctions are events, either held physically or online, where wooden pallets are offered to the greatest bidder. These auctions might feature a range of pallets, ranging from standard sizes to special or specialized designs, catering to various purchaser needs-- from makers seeking bulk pallets for shipping to craftsmens searching for functional wood for crafting tasks.

Taking part in a wooden pallet auction can be straightforward, however a couple of essential actions can assist guarantee a successful bidding experience:
Research the Auction: Before getting involved, familiarize yourself with the auction home's track record and the type of pallets offered. Check out evaluations and understand bidding procedures.
Set a Budget: Determine just how much you're willing to invest. Consist of additional expenses such as buyer premiums or transport charges.
Examine the Pallets: If possible, physically check the pallets before bidding to assess their condition, size, and suitability for your task.
Know Your Needs: Have a clear concept of the type and amount of pallets you require. Different designs and conditions affect their value.
Stay Updated: Subscribe to auction updates and sneak peek the lots to ensure you don't miss any interesting offerings.
Quote Strategically: Begin bidding below your maximum limit to assess interest from other bidders. Incrementally increase your bids if required, however avoid getting brought away by competition.
